A comprehensive guide to managing and mitigating natural disasters Β Β
Recent years have seen a surge in the number, frequency, and severity of natural disasters, with further increases expected as the climate continues to change. However, advanced computational and geospatial technologies have enabled the development of sophisticated early warning systems and techniques to predict, manage, and mitigate disasters.Techniques for Disaster Risk Management and Mitigation explores different approaches to forecasting disasters and provides guidance on mitigation and adaptation strategies.
Volume highlights include:Β
- Review of current and emerging technologies for disaster prediction
- Different approaches to risk management and mitigation
- Strategies for implementing disaster plans and infrastructure improvements
- Guidance on integrating artificial intelligence with GIS and earth observation data
- Examination of the regional and global impacts of disasters under climate variability
